Abstract
Exemplary embodiments for programming a network device using user-defined scripts are disclosed. The systems and methods provide for a servicing node to receive a request for a network session between a client device and a server, receive a user defined class and a user defined object configuration from a node controller, and use the information to instruct an object virtual machine to generate at least one user defined object. The servicing node can then apply the at least one user defined object to a data packet of the network session, where the user defined object allows a user to configure the network device with user-defined instruction scripts.
